It’s not often that players hear from an AD directly. But, apparently it happens at Illinois, as one basketball star will attest.
On Thursday, Genesis Bryant posted a picture of a letter from Illinois AD Josh Whitman addressed to her. Along with a letter praising her accomplishments, a hand-written note was added at the bottom from the AD saying “Congrats Genesis, Keep it Rolling!” Bryant was recently honored as the B1G Co-Player of the Week, along with ESPN’s Player of the Week.
Bryant also took the opportunity to address future recruits, stating in her caption “you want to play for a university where the athletic director mails you personal congratulations letters.”

Bryant picked up the position of guard at Illinois after transferring from NC State in 2022. She picked up POW honors after recording a ‘triple-double’ (20 points, 12 assists, 10 rebounds) against Florida Atlantic. Bryant is only the third player in Illini history to record a triple-double.
